Add an API to directly execute dart code? #6

First of all thank you very much for your work, I happen to have the need to embed the Dart VM to execute the code. Here is the code I read in dart_api_impl_test.cc and it seems that the VM can execute Dart code directly in string form:

TEST_CASE(DartAPI_InstanceOf) {
  const char* kScriptChars =
      "class OtherClass {\n"
      "  static returnNull() { return null; }\n"
      "}\n"
      "class InstanceOfTest {\n"
      "  InstanceOfTest() {}\n"
      "  static InstanceOfTest testMain() {\n"
      "    return new InstanceOfTest();\n"
      "  }\n"
      "}\n";
  Dart_Handle result;
  // Create a test library and Load up a test script in it.
  Dart_Handle lib = TestCase::LoadTestScript(kScriptChars, NULL);

  // Fetch InstanceOfTest class.
  Dart_Handle type =
      Dart_GetNonNullableType(lib, NewString("InstanceOfTest"), 0, NULL);
  EXPECT_VALID(type);

  // Invoke a function which returns an object of type InstanceOf..
  Dart_Handle instanceOfTestObj =
      Dart_Invoke(type, NewString("testMain"), 0, NULL);
  EXPECT_VALID(instanceOfTestObj);

}

Can you add an API like TestCase::LoadTestScript?
